I'm putting together a Priesthood Lesson ....
I've been looking for a way to create a web URL to an LDS.org conference talk that I can embed in a Google Slides (or power point) presentation that will bring up video of a selected portion (6:30-8:20) of the talk in full-screen mode. I know how YouTube handles this type of linking, but can't get anything to work at LDS.org.
Is there a way to create a URL to do this? Is anyone at LDS.org working on adding this capability in the near future?

This isn't currently possible on LDS.org videos; only on videos at YouTube.com. It would be helpful in some contexts, but since it's possible to do this on YouTube I don't think there's much incentive for them to add the functionality on LDS.org.

Further, you really don't want to rely on building internet being available and fast enough during that time. Better would be to download the video (often do-able even when there's no download link), then edit the video to clip out the bits you don't want, and embed the edited video file (now on the same computer as will show the presentation) into the presentation.
